source from: pexels
如何扒网页上图标:引言
在当今数字化时代,网页图标已成为网站不可或缺的元素。它们不仅提升了网站的视觉效果,还在一定程度上增强了用户体验。然而,如何高效扒取网页图标,对于设计师和开发者来说却是一大难题。本文将深入探讨网页图标在日常工作和设计中的重要性,并提出一种高效扒取网页图标的方法和技巧,旨在激发读者的兴趣,帮助他们更好地掌握这一实用技能。接下来,我们将一起了解网页图标的基本概念、常见图标格式,以及如何利用浏览器开发者工具轻松定位和下载图标。
一、准备工作:了解网页图标
1、网页图标的基本概念
网页图标,又称为网页小图标或favicon,是网站的重要组成部分。它通常位于浏览器地址栏左侧,代表网站的品牌形象。一个设计精美、符合网站风格的图标,能够提升用户体验,增强网站的辨识度。
2、常见图标格式介绍(PNG、SVG等)
网页图标常见的格式有PNG、SVG、ICO等。PNG格式支持透明背景,适合大多数网站使用;SVG格式矢量图形,可无限放大而不失真,适合响应式网站;ICO格式是Windows系统的专用图标格式,适用于Windows平台。
格式 | 优点 | 缺点 |
---|---|---|
PNG | 支持透明背景,兼容性好 | 文件体积较大 |
SVG | 矢量图形,可无限放大 | 不支持透明背景 |
ICO | 适用于Windows平台 | 格式较为古老 |
了解网页图标的格式和特点,有助于我们在扒取和下载图标时,选择合适的格式。
二、使用浏览器开发者工具定位图标
1、打开开发者工具(按F12)
为了定位网页上的图标,第一步是打开浏览器的开发者工具。在现代浏览器中,这一般可以通过按F12键或者右键点击页面元素,选择“检查”或“Inspect”来实现。这一步是扒取图标的基础,因为它能让我们直接看到页面的HTML和CSS代码,从而找到图标的线索。
2、右键点击图标选择“检查”
在页面中找到你想要扒取的图标,右键点击它,然后从菜单中选择“检查”或“Inspect”。这一操作会将图标所在的元素高亮显示在开发者工具的“Elements”面板中,方便我们进行后续的操作。
3、在“Elements”面板中查找图标元素
打开开发者工具后,你应该会看到三个主要面板:“Elements”、“Console”和“Network”。点击“Elements”面板,你可以看到当前页面所有元素的层级结构。滚动或使用搜索功能,找到包含图标的元素。图标元素可能是一个
标签,也可能是一个CSS背景图。
在“Elements”面板中,你可以双击图标元素来查看其HTML属性。特别是,你需要找到src
属性,它包含了图标的链接。对于CSS背景图,你需要查找应用背景的元素,并在其样式规则中寻找background-image
属性,从中提取URL。
注意: 如果图标被嵌入到CSS样式中,可能需要深入到“CSS”面板或直接在源代码中查找相关样式。例如,一个图标可能被定义为.icon { background-image: url(\\\'icon.png\\\'); }
。
通过上述步骤,你不仅能够找到图标的URL,还可以确定其格式(例如PNG或SVG)。接下来,你可以复制链接并下载图标,或者处理CSS中的图标链接,具体操作将在下一部分进行说明。
三、提取图标链接并下载
在确定了图标的位置之后,接下来就需要提取图标的链接并进行下载。以下是具体步骤:
1、找到图标链接并复制
在“Elements”面板中,找到包含图标的HTML元素。图标链接通常位于元素的src
属性中,例如
。右键点击该元素,选择“复制”->“复制链接地址”或直接右键点击图标本身,选择“复制图片地址”。
2、打开新标签页粘贴链接下载
在新标签页中粘贴复制的链接地址,按下回车键。此时,浏览器会自动打开链接指向的图片页面。右键点击图片,选择“另存为”即可下载图标。
3、处理嵌入CSS中的图标链接
有时候,图标链接会被嵌入到CSS代码中。在这种情况下,可以在“Elements”面板中查找包含图标的样式规则。右键点击该规则,选择“编辑样式”,在弹出的面板中找到background-image
属性,提取其中的URL,然后按照上述步骤进行下载。
注意:在进行图标下载时,请确保遵循网站的使用条款和版权政策。未经允许下载他人网站图标可能侵犯版权。
四、高级技巧:批量扒取和处理图标
1. 使用插件或脚本批量下载
当需要批量扒取网页图标时,手动下载显然效率低下。此时,我们可以借助一些浏览器插件或脚本,实现自动批量下载。例如,浏览器插件“图床大师”就提供了这样的功能,用户只需在网页中选中所有需要下载的图标,一键即可完成批量下载。
2. 图标优化与格式转换
下载后的图标,可能存在格式不适合当前网站设计的情况。此时,我们可以利用在线图标格式转换工具,将图标格式转换为所需格式。常用的在线转换工具包括在线PNG转SVG、在线PNG压缩等。这些工具可以帮助我们优化图标,提高网页加载速度。
表格展示:
工具名称 | 功能介绍 | 适用场景 |
---|---|---|
图床大师 | 批量下载网页图标 | 适合需要大量图标下载的用户 |
在线PNG转SVG | 将PNG格式图标转换为SVG格式 | 需要使用SVG格式的图标时 |
在线PNG压缩 | 压缩PNG格式图标,减小文件大小 | 提高网页加载速度时 |
通过以上高级技巧,我们可以更高效地扒取和处理网页图标,为网站设计提供更多选择。
结语:高效获取网页图标的实用指南
总结本文提供的扒取网页图标的方法和技巧,我们可以看到,通过使用浏览器开发者工具、提取图标链接以及处理嵌入CSS中的图标链接,我们能够轻松地获取网页上的图标。这些方法不仅便捷,而且高效,能够极大地提高我们的工作效率。我们鼓励读者们尝试这些技巧,并将它们应用到实际工作中,以提升个人技能和设计效率。
常见问题
-
为什么有些图标无法直接下载?有些图标可能由于网站版权保护或者技术限制而无法直接下载。此时,可以考虑尝试其他浏览器或开发者工具,或者寻找类似的替代图标资源。
-
如何处理跨域问题导致的图标下载失败?跨域问题可能导致部分图标下载失败。此时,可以使用网络抓包工具如Fiddler或Burp Suite进行调试,修改请求头以绕过跨域限制。
-
扒取的图标是否有版权问题?扒取的图标可能存在版权问题。建议在使用前了解图标的版权信息,或寻找可免费使用的开源图标资源。
-
有没有推荐的图标下载工具或插件?目前市面上有许多图标下载工具或插件,例如Iconfinder、Flaticon等,这些工具提供了丰富的图标资源,可以方便地搜索和下载所需的图标。
原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/71263.html